  • Step-by-Step Guide to Consultation of the Electoral Register

    Performing a consultation of the electoral register CNE is a straightforward process that can be completed online or in person. Below is a step-by-step guide to help you navigate this process:

    Step 1: Access the Official CNE Website

    Begin by visiting the official website of the National Electoral Council (www.cne.gob.ve). This platform provides all the necessary tools and resources for voter verification.

    Step 2: Locate the Voter Verification Section

    Once on the website, navigate to the "Electoral Register" or "Voter Verification" section. This is where you can initiate the consultation process.

    Step 3: Enter Your Identification Information

    To verify your voter status, you will need to provide your identification number (Cédula de Identidad). Ensure that the information you enter is accurate and up-to-date.

    Step 4: Review Your Voter Information

    After submitting your details, the system will display your voter information, including your polling station location and voting status. Take note of any discrepancies and address them promptly.

    Common Issues and How to Resolve Them

    During the consultation of the electoral register CNE, you may encounter various issues. Below are some common problems and their solutions:

    Problem 1: Incorrect Voter Information

    If your voter information is incorrect or outdated, you can request an update by visiting a local CNE office or submitting an online form.

    Problem 2: Missing Voter Status

    In some cases, individuals may not appear on the electoral register. If this happens, contact the CNE to initiate a registration process.

    Problem 3: Technical Difficulties

    Technical issues with the online platform can occur. In such cases, try accessing the website during off-peak hours or visit a CNE office for assistance.

    To be eligible for voter registration and participate in the consultation of the electoral register CNE, individuals must meet certain legal requirements. These include:

    • Being a Venezuelan citizen
    • Being at least 18 years old
    • Providing a valid identification document (Cédula de Identidad)

    Meeting these requirements ensures that your voter registration is valid and that you can fully participate in the electoral process.

    How to Update Your Voter Information

    Keeping your voter information up-to-date is essential for ensuring your participation in elections. Below are the steps to update your information:

    Step 1: Gather Required Documentation

    Collect all necessary documents, including your identification card and proof of address.

    Step 2: Visit a Local CNE Office

    Schedule an appointment at your nearest CNE office to submit your updated information.

    Step 3: Verify the Update

    After submitting your changes, perform another consultation of the electoral register CNE to confirm that your information has been updated successfully.

    Frequently Asked Questions About CNE Electoral Register

    Q1: Can I perform a consultation of the electoral register CNE from outside Venezuela?

    Yes, the CNE provides online tools that allow Venezuelan citizens living abroad to verify their voter information.

    Q2: What should I do if my name is not on the electoral register?

    Contact the CNE to initiate a registration process. Ensure that you provide all necessary documentation to support your application.

    Q3: How often should I check my voter information?

    It is recommended to perform a consultation of the electoral register CNE at least once a year to ensure that your information remains accurate and up-to-date.
